a few weeks ago, my car started needing a jump to start. then it would be fine for a few days.
finally i replaced the battery. needed to jump it to start it.
the next day it was dead. i replaced the alternator. when i went to hook the battery back up, it sparked and popped the 120a alt fuse. i replaced the fuse. tried it again with the same result.

the battery is not connected backwards, i had only originally removed the negative cable.

i removed the power to the starter and tried to hook up the battery. same problem.

i can find no loose or broken cables. i also replaced the battery post connectors.

i hadn't noticed any other problems prior to the battery being dead.

any ideas? thsnk you for your time.

You were not getting the sparks until you changed the alternator. Are you sure you hooked it up correctly?

I would disconnect the alternator – wrap the positive hot wire so it doesn’t ground out. Then see if you get the same results when you hook the battery up.

Then if not, disconnect the battery and ensure you are hooking the alternator up correctly.

Again, it doesn’t seem like there was a problem until the alternator change.
